We apologize for the inconvenience.Located in the heart of Fontvieille, across from the Princess Grace Rose Garden, with views out to the Mediterranean Sea the hotel is both central and secluded. The Princes Palace of Monaco and the Louis II Stadium are within one kilometer. The Oceanographic Museum of Monaco is 10 minutes away. Our savvy guests can enjoy a meal in our Mediterranean restaurant Tavolo or relax in our informal and sophisticated bar. We also have a 24-hour fitness center and a seasonal outdoor pool.

The Green Key

Green Key is an eco-label awarded to around 3,200 hotels and other sites in more than 65 countries worldwide. Achieving the Green Key award requires compliance with a range of criteria, including:

• Comply with legislation and CSR policy within the areas of environment, health, safety, and labor
• Prepare an environmental/sustainability policy and action plan
• Train staff on environmental/sustainability issues
• Display information about Green Key and other environmental/sustainability initiatives
• Display information about local transportation and nearby parks/conservation areas
• Implement water-saving initiatives in guest rooms, e.g. flow restrictors in taps and showers, smart watering initiatives of the garden, etc.
• Install program for the reuse of towels and/or sheets in guest rooms
• Separate waste and implementation of waste saving initiatives (including food waste)
• Avoid the use of chemical cleaning products with dangerous compounds
• Safe storage of chemical products
• Stationary and paper are environmentally friendly produced
• Implement energy-saving initiatives in guest rooms, e.g. energy-efficient light bulbs, standard-defined heating/cooling temperature, etc.
• Purchase of food/beverage products that are organic, eco-labeled, fair-trade labeled, and/or locally produced
• Avoid chemical pesticides and fertilizers in green areas
• Staff areas fulfill the same requirements as guests and public areas
• Encourage cooperation with suppliers and local community on environmental/sustainability matters
